LAHORE TRANSPORT COMPANY
CONCEPT PAPER ON VEHICLE INSPECTION AND CERTIFICATION SYSTEM
1.0 PRESENT SITUATION IN LAHORE
Vehicle inspection is a procedure mandated by national or provincial governments
in many countries, in which a vehicle is inspected to ensure that it conforms to
regulations governing safety, emissions, etc. Inspection can be required at various times,
e.g., periodically or on transfer of title to a vehicle. If required periodically, it is often
termed periodic motor vehicle inspection; typical intervals are every two years and every
year.
The exponential growth in vehicle population and dominance of old vintage
vehicles on Lahore make the issue of inspection and maintenance a prime concern in
Government of Punjab. In Lahore there exists a mandatory system for inspection and
certification. Unfortunately this system is anachronistic and urgently requires up
gradation to meet present day requirements. Every commercial vehicle in Lahore has to
obtain a mandatory fitness certificate after every six months. This fitness certification is
carried out by the motor vehicle inspectorate; known as Motor Vehicle Examiners, which
is attached to the Transport Department. However, for private vehicles no mandatory
periodic fitness check is required in Lahore. The Motor Vehicle Examiner, by and large,
depend on visual checks and limited road tests (for checking brakes) for inspecting the
vehicles for fitness certification.
2.0 DRAWBACK OF FITNESS CERTIFICATION IN LAHORE
The menace of exhaust emissions from old vintage on-road vehicles and
increasing number of road accidents call for a comprehensive and efficient vehicle fitness
certification system in Lahore. Though there exists a system of fitness certification,
proper implementation and functioning of the system has been a concern for long. The
existing system being inefficient and inclined more to visual checks encourages false
passes and corruptions. Concerns of road accidents due to mechanical failure of vehicles
and problems of vehicle fitness can only be tackled by putting in place Vehicle Inspection
and Testing Centre (VICS).Some of the gaps in the existing system are outlined below:
Lack of adequate testing facility Number of vehicle inspectors is limited and the skill set of Motor Vehicle
Examiners needs to be improved
Only commercial vehicles are required to go for fitness tests. All categories ofvehicles should be brought under the ambit of fitness testing.
Fitness is more a practice in paper then in reality. This gives scope for corruption,which exist in Lahore.

No auditing and quality assurance is carried out at the test centers and as a resultthe measurements are not reproducible.
Scope for false certificates exists in this system. It is estimated that morbidity and mortality figures, due to pollution caused by
emission, run in thousands.
Considering the above problems in Lahore, more stress for setting up better test
facilities is required. Experiences of other countries may play a vital role in designing anefficient fitness testing system and participation from international donor/experts may
also be considered for establishment of test centers.
3.0 VEHICEL INSPECTION AND CERTIFICAITON SYSTEM DETAILS
3.1 Land Space for VICS
LTC intends to provide space for VICS in collaboration with Government of
Punjab which is estimated as 4635 sq meter. The Land space would be enough to
accommodate required facilities like administration building, testing bay, Parking area,
inspection sheds, waiting lodge etc.
3.2 EQUIPMENT IN VICS
Lahore Transport Company intends to set up a modern test facility, which is meant
for testing and certification of Public Transport Vehicle as well as private vehicle. The
center has the following test equipments:
Emission measurement systems Brake Tester Head Light Tester Side Slip Tester Computerized Wheel Alignment System Sound Level Meter

3.5 FITNESS TEST FACILITY
The following items are required to be tested and certified under fitness test;
Table-2: Items for Fitness test
Items Checks
Tires Cut, deformation, thread
Steering Gear backlash, kingpin, stub axle, free play
Engine Noise Level (85 dB)
Suspension Leaf spring position, clamping, shock absorber, bushes, shackle, centrebolt
Horn Electrical, bulb, pressure horn
Brake Total brake effort >45%, stopping distance at 30 kmph

4.0 ESTIMATED COST OF THE PROJECT
The project has estimated cost of one Million dollar which includes cost of equipment,
capacity building of VICS staff, building construction, and power supply.
5.0 ECONOMIC, FINANCIAL AND ENVIRNOMENTAL BENEFIT OF THE PROJECT
5.1 Financial benefits
Periodic inspection and certification with advance tool will become a source ofrevenue for the government and the system will generate annual revenue of Rs.
30 Million.
5.2 Economic benefits
Systematic inspection of vehicles will increase life of vehicles. Inspection and certification will reduce accidents and time saving caused by
breakdown so will be a source of money saving for government and people.
5.3 Environmental benefits
Removal of outdated vehicles from the system will improve quality of life The content of PM10, CO2 and other pollutants will be reduced. The morbidity and mortality caused from emission of pollutant from defective
vehicle will be reduced.
6.0 MECHANIC TRAINING SCHOOL
Government of Punjab is in process to amend Motor Vehicle Ordinance for new
standard of inspection, maintenance and Roadworthiness in Lahore and, establishment ofmore vehicle inspection and certification centers in Punjab, which will warrant for
immediate demands of more skilled staff in transport industry for new VICS branches as
well as for maintenance of existing vehicle population in Punjab. So there is dire need of
establishment of Mechanic Training School in Lahore to meet the future requirement of
transport industry as well as make available required skilled manpower for new VICS
centre. The Mechanic Training School will be equipped with advance equipment and
periodic refresher course. The Mechanic Training School will also become source of
employment generation in Punjab. The estimated cost of the Project is one million US
dollar which includes cost of equipment, construction cost, capacity building and training
courses. The land for the School will be provided by Government of Punjab.
